SyntaxThe Polynomial type exposes the following members.
 Constructors
Constructors| Name | Description | |
|---|---|---|
|  | Polynomial | Constructs the zero polynomial, that is, the polynomial, p(x), that satisfies p(x) = 0 for all x. | 
|  | Polynomial(Double) | Constructs a Polynomial instance with the given coefficients. | 
|  | Polynomial(DoubleVector) | Constructs a Polynomial instance with the given coefficients. | 
|  | Polynomial(DoubleVector, DoubleVector) | Constructs a polynomial which passes through the given set of points. | 
|  | Polynomial(DoubleVector, OneVariableFunction) | Construct a polynomial that interpolates a function. If the number of interpolation points is n, then the constructed polynomial, p(x), will be have degree n - 1 and agree with the passed function at the passed interpolation points. Specifically, p will satisfy p(interpolationPoints[i]) = function(interpolationPoints[i]) for each i = 0, 1,...,n. | 
|  | Polynomial(SerializationInfo, StreamingContext) | Constructs a Polynomial instance from serialization information. |
